how to make Texas Sheet Cake

Ingredients:

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 2 cups sugar
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1 cup unsalted butter
  • 1 cup water
  • 1/2 cup unsweetened cocoa powder
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1/2 cup buttermilk
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1/2 cup unsweetened cocoa powder (for frosting)
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ter (for frosting)
  • 1/4 cup milk (for frosting)
  • 4 cups powdered sugar (for frosting)

Directions:

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and flour a large baking sheet.
  2. In a large mixing bowl, combine flour, sugar, baking soda, and salt.
  3. In a saucepan, melt the butter, then stir in water and cocoa, bringing it to a boil. Pour this mixture over the flour mixture and mix well.
  4. In another bowl, whisk together the eggs, buttermilk, and vanilla. Stir this into the batter until combined.
  5. Pour the batter into the prepared baking sheet and bake for 20-25 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
  6. For the frosting, melt the butter, stir in cocoa and milk, then whisk in powdered sugar.
  7. Once the cake is cool, pour the chocolate frosting over the top and spread it evenly.

how to store Texas Sheet Cake

To store leftover Texas Sheet Cake, keep it covered in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days. You can also refrigerate it for about a week. For longer storage, consider freezing the cake. Wrap it tightly in plastic wrap and then in aluminum foil, and it can last for up to 3 months.

tips to make Texas Sheet Cake

  • Use room temperature ingredients for a smoother batter.
  • Don’t overmix the batter; mix just until combined for a fluffy cake.
  • If you want a more intense chocolate flavor, use dark cocoa powder for the frosting.
  • You can add chopped nuts, like pecans or walnuts, to the batter for added texture.

FAQs

Can I use a different type of flour for this recipe?
Yes, you can use whole wheat flour, but it might change the texture slightly.

Can I make this cake ahead of time?
Absolutely! Texas Sheet Cake stays moist and delicious for several days, so it’s perfect for making in advance.

What can I do if I don’t have buttermilk?
You can create a substitute by mixing 1/2 cup of milk with 1/2 tablespoon of vinegar or lemon juice. Let it sit for a few minutes to curdle, then use it in place of buttermilk.
